Hari Avenue Park
Hari Avenue Park is a park in Kundrathur, Kanchipuram, Tamil Nadu which is located on Dr Shree Hari Avenue, Friends Nagar. Hari Avenue Park is situated nearby to the Hindu temple Velleeswarar Temple - Mangadu, as well as near the pond Kamakshi Amman Temple Tank.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Poonamallee is a western suburb of Chennai, India under the Chennai Metropolitan Area. It was historically called Pushpagirimangalam, later renamed in Tamil as Poovirundhavalli, and now colloquially called as Poondhamalli.

Kundrathur is a suburb located in the Chennai Metropolitan Area and the headquarters of Kundrathur taluk in Kanchipuram District. It is the birthplace of Sekkizhar, a well-known poet-saint who authored the Periyapuranam. Kundrathur is situated 3½ km south of Hari Avenue Park.

Thiruverkadu is a western suburb of Chennai, Tamil Nadu. It comes under Thiruvallur district administration. It is famous for its Devi Karumariamman Temple. Tiruverkadu is situated 5 km north of Hari Avenue Park.
